Position Overview
Reporting to the CEO, the Cyber Security Project Manager serves as the primary coordinator and point of contact for all contractor activities, ensuring timely and quality delivery of both the Professional IT Security Consulting Services and the annual Cyber Resiliency Assessment. This role manages project planning, scheduling, communications, and reporting, including bi-weekly status updates and monthly progression reports. The Project Manager oversees task execution across technical and assessment-related workstreams, ensures compliance with customer requirements, facilitates meetings with stakeholders, and maintains alignment between customer objectives and contractor performance.
Required Qualifications
- Active Top Secret/SCI Security clearance
- Active PMP
- Active CISSP, CISM, or CGRC/CAP
-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Engineering, or related field.
- 7 years project or program management experience in IT security, cybersecurity consulting, or federal IT modernization.
- Demonstrated experience managing multi-disciplinary cybersecurity teams including:
- Security architecture
- Cloud security
- Policy & governance
- Compliance & assessments
- Vulnerability management
- Experience delivering projects supporting federal cybersecurity frameworks (e.g., NIST 800-53, NIST CSF, Zero Trust).
- Experience with hybrid contracts (Labor-Hour FFP) and managing deliverables and hours tracking.
- Strong background in producing and managing technical documentation, reports, and client communication.
